ABSTRACT:
All available timeslots for interconnecting a circuit between two endpoints in a telecommunications network are considered for selecting and establishing the path wherein the selecting step may be carried out according to the rule of first feasible timeslot and wherein bandwidth may be determined as being equal to the lowest count among the timeslots determined to be feasible in each network element in a given path and wherein the total bandwidth in the network between two endpoints is determined by adding the bandwidths determined for each possible path.
